Non-asbestos organic and natural pads (often called ceramic pads) applied on most GM cars in North The united states acquire a transfer film, a layer of fabric over the pad and rotor area that functions being a cushion (at a microscopic scale) among the brake pad and rotor, defending each from abrasive interaction that causes have on.

A: GM Brake pads are equipped with dress in indicators that create a squealing sounds if the brakes are Virtually worn out. The noise may very well be current with or without the brake pedal used, but when noise is read within the use indicator, the brake pads ought to get replaced without delay.

Brake pulsation is not really because of warping of the disc. However, distortion from the disc because of excessive temperatures or improper installation and torqueing of your wheels may lead to brake rotor thickness variation eventually. Brake-pedal pulsation is corrected by turning and/or changing the brake rotors to reduce the thickness variation.
